Note spacing is very important to me in typesetting hymnals. Notes can shift a little to compensate for lyrics, but they can’t become lopsided, with an eighth and a quarter getting the same horizontal space within a single measure (just my opinion).
I’m having good success with the “Minimum gap between adjacent lyrics” set to 1/4 (which requires some minor tweaking of lyrics, but not nearly as much as Finale did). But what I don’t quite fully understand is “Proportion of lyric width for horizontal adjustment.” I read the description and get the idea, but I’m still not totally clear on it.
